We are hiring for multiple Product roles across a few of our key pillars, you will be very familiar with systems thinking and how technical decisions can impact the users directly.
As a Lead Product Manager, you'll work closely with a cross-functional squad of engineers, designers, data scientists, analysts and writers on an area focused around building our understanding of user data.
Leading the product strategy for Cleo’s product experiences
Collaborating closely with ML engineers, data scientists and analysts to launch key new products with a global focus
Defining and track success metrics related to customer engagement, retention, and financial well-being
Prioritising high-impact opportunities and ruthlessly focus your squad on what matters most
Translating complex data capabilities (e.g. LLMs and ML models) into intuitive user experiences
Ensuring your squad is aligned and involved in product direction and key decisions
Continuously iterating on the product based on user insights, data, and testing outcomes
Extensive product management experience, building highly technical products
Experience working with machine learning modelling, Credit Risk or data science-driven features
Proficiency in systems thinking - you will be able to work directly with developers and tech leads on a daily basis
Strong prioritisation skills with the ability to focus your team on impactful work
Collaborative and inclusive leadership style with a track record of empowering cross-functional teams
Ability to clearly communicate product decisions and trade-offs to stakeholders
Creativity in approaching product challenges and rethinking how people manage their finances
High energy and ownership mindset with a focus on driving measurable outcomes
Passion for building tools that improve users’ financial lives through engaging, meaningful conversations
Company wide
Meaningful equity with early exercise, plus top-ups on promotion
Paid 1-month sabbatical every 4 years
Comprehensive health, dental & vision insurance
Learning & development training platform
Mental health support via Spill
Company-wide performance reviews every 4 months
We’ll cover your OpenAI or Claude subscription
Access to a global workspace booking tool that gives you on-demand access to thousands of high-quality flexible workspaces for remote employees.
UK
Pension match up to 6%
Life assurance
25 days annual leave + an extra day for every year you’re at Cleo (up to five accrued days)
Primary caregiver: 18 weeks at full pay / Secondary caregiver: 6 weeks full pay, 6 weeks half pay (dependant on tenure)
